Develop a Classification System for Streamlined Junk Removal
An efficient sorting system is vital for simplifying the junk removal process. By categorizing items, homeowners can more easily figure out what to keep, donate, recycle, or discard. The first step involves gathering containers or bags labeled for each category. This visual aid aids in maintaining focus during the sorting activity.
Next, one should carefully address each zone, putting items into their corresponding containers as they progress. It is wise to be realistic about the need of each item, asking whether it delivers value or joy. Using a timer can also boost productivity, encouraging prompt decisions and minimizing second-guessing.
Once sorting is finished, the next step is to transfer items from the designated containers to their final destinations. This structured approach not only simplifies the junk removal process but also cultivates a sense of accomplishment, ultimately creating a more decluttered and serene living space.

Gather Your Essential Decluttering Supplies
While starting on a decluttering journey, having the right tools at hand can substantially streamline the process. Important tools include sturdy boxes or bins for sorting items into categories such as keep, donate, and discard. Labeling materials, including markers and adhesive labels, help confirm that each box is easily identifiable, facilitating the decision-making process. A tape measure can also be beneficial for determining whether larger items fit into designated spaces.
Additionally, garbage bags are crucial for quickly disposing of discarded items. For items that demand special handling, such as electronics or hazardous materials, it's crucial to have a plan and appropriate containers. To conclude, a notebook or digital app can help with tracking progress and jotting down ideas regarding future organization. By arming yourself with these key decluttering tools, the journey toward a better organized and clutter-free space becomes considerably more manageable.
Suggestions for Sustainable Organization After Decluttering
Establishing sustainable organization after decluttering necessitates steady habits and thoughtful planning. To maintain an organized space, individuals should implement a routine for ongoing tidying. This can include setting aside a particular time each week to review belongings and return items to their designated places.
Making use of storage solutions, such as bins or shelves, can also aid in organize items sorted and easily accessible. Labeling these storage containers guarantees clarity, making it easier to identify necessary items without digging through clutter.
Additionally, establishing a one-in-one-out approach can stop future accumulation. This means that for every new item added to the home, an old item should be eliminated.
Lastly, periodically reviewing the space and belongings can assist in identifying any new clutter and resolve it immediately, promoting a lasting organizational system. By applying these strategies, individuals can enjoy a clutter-free environment for the long term.

Hazardous Materials Handling
Managing hazardous materials requires careful consideration and expertise, as incorrect disposal can pose significant health and safety risks. Items such as batteries, paints, chemicals, and electronic waste contain substances that can harm the environment and human health if not dealt with appropriately. It is vital for individuals to recognize when these materials are present and to comprehend the legal regulations related to their disposal. In cases involving hazardous waste, hiring professional junk removal services is advisable. These experts are trained to identify, handle, and dispose of hazardous materials safely and in compliance with local laws. By calling in the pros, individuals can ensure their space is decluttered without sacrificing safety or the environment.

What Are the Proper Steps to Recycle Electronic Waste?
To properly recycle electronic waste, you should identify certified e-waste recycling centers, adhere to local regulations, and ensure devices are wiped clean of personal data ahead of disposal. This encourages environmental sustainability and reduces harmful landfill impact.
